The Fortress and the Flow: How Digital Public Infrastructure and the War for Liabilities Are Rewriting Indian Banking

1. Cold Open & The Upstream Belief: The Great Indian Balance Sheet Reset and the Frictionless Rupee

Start with a transaction that now repeats, in some version, several hundred million times a day across India.

A tea vendor in Jaipur takes a twenty-rupee payment. There is no cash, no change, no till. The customer scans a printed QR code taped to the counter, and the money moves between two bank accounts through the Unified Payments Interface β€” the national payments switch that in early 2026 was clearing more than 15.2 billion transactions a month, worth over β‚Ή20.6 lakh crore.1 The vendor pays nothing for the rail. The bank on either side earns nothing directly from that β‚Ή20.

What the bank earns is a record. Every one of those receipts lands in a ledger with a timestamp, and twelve months of them describe a business more honestly than any balance sheet the vendor could produce, because the vendor has never produced one. When that vendor opens a lending app and consents β€” through the Account Aggregator framework, a consent-based data-sharing protocol whose ecosystem had crossed 110 million cumulative account links by early 2026 β€” the lender pulls those statements directly, encrypted, in seconds.2 A pre-approved working capital line of β‚Ή25,000 can be sanctioned before the next customer arrives. No land deed. No gold. No guarantor. No branch visit.

The vendor is a composite drawn from the mechanics of the system rather than from a single documented case. The mechanics are not. This is the standard operating model of lenders such as AU Small Finance Bank, which built its franchise underwriting exactly this customer β€” self-employed, semi-urban, cash-flow-visible, with no formal financial history β€” and which reported net interest margins near 5.50% and advances growing about 24% year on year in FY26.3

Now rewind eleven years. In 2015 the Reserve Bank of India ordered an Asset Quality Review that forced banks to stop pretending. Loans to steel mills, power projects and infrastructure holding companies that had been quietly evergreened for years were dragged onto the books as what they were, and system gross non-performing assets climbed from around 4.3% to a peak of 11.5% by FY2018.4 In that world a small business loan required a site visit, a valuer's report on immovable property, months of file movement, and a credit officer's judgement about a borrower whose cash flows were invisible by design. The economics were brutal in both directions: the loan cost too much to originate, and the collateral behind it turned out, in aggregate, to be worth far less than the paper said.

Between those two scenes sits the question this article is about. Something in India changed the physics of making a loan. The question for an investor is whether the profits from that change accrue to the institutions that made it, and if so, which ones.

Why we looked here

The belief that sent us into Indian banking is a claim about household behaviour rather than about banks, and it can be stated as a single falsifiable proposition:

India's transition toward formal financialization β€” driven by digital public infrastructure, per-capita GDP crossing roughly $2,500, and the economic integration of rural and urban India β€” is permanently re-routing household savings out of physical, non-yielding assets and into formal bank intermediation, payment rails and capital-market channels, creating an expanding, high-margin, low-credit-cost intermediation pool for well-capitalised lenders.

Permanently is the load-bearing word. India has had bursts of financial deepening before, and they have reversed. The evidence that this one is different comes from three streams that are collected independently of each other and, crucially, independently of the banks whose share prices are at stake.

The first is macro and demographic. Household gross financial savings recovered to roughly 11.2% of gross national disposable income in FY25–FY26, after several years in which inflation pushed households back toward gold and unorganised property.4 Underneath that aggregate sits an infrastructure fact: the Pradhan Mantri Jan Dhan Yojana programme had opened more than 520 million basic bank accounts holding over β‚Ή2.3 lakh crore β€” around $27.5 billion β€” by early 2026, most of them operationally active rather than dormant.5 These come from central bank deposit registries and ministry audits, not bank marketing decks.

The second stream is behavioural, and it matters most because it measures what people do rather than what they own. UPI volumes and Account Aggregator consent counts are recorded at the switch level and in open-banking API logs. Fifteen billion transactions a month is not a survey response.

The third stream comes from sibling industries β€” places where the same household rupee would show up if the belief were true. Monthly systematic investment plan inflows into Indian mutual funds pushed past β‚Ή24,000 crore, roughly $2.85 billion a month, in early 2026, and retail credit bureau coverage expanded past 440 million unique individuals.67 A country still hoarding cash and metal would run neither.

How the belief reaches a bank's income statement

Three transmission channels carry this shift into bank fundamentals, and they hit different parts of the P&L. The liability engine converts physical currency and informal savings into digital deposits: frictionless onboarding turns a cash-economy participant into a current-and-savings-account holder, the cheapest funding a bank can obtain. The asset engine replaces collateral with cash-flow data, so a lender prices risk on observed receipts rather than on the liquidation value of a pledged asset β€” collapsing customer acquisition cost, by industry estimates on the order of 60–70% for digitally originated retail and MSME credit, and changing which borrowers are lendable at all. The operating efficiency channel is the arithmetic consequence: paperless origination and digital servicing pull cost-to-income ratios down from the historical Indian norm of roughly 50–55% toward 38–44% at the technology-led private lenders.

The same belief implicates a set of adjacent industries this article deliberately does not chase: asset managers capturing the discretionary savings that overflow past deposit rates, life and general insurers riding credit-linked distribution, and non-bank finance companies operating at the high-yield boundary of the credit grid while borrowing wholesale from the very banks they compete with.

The decision context, stated plainly

This piece is written for a general institutional public-equity reader with a three-to-five-year thematic horizon, evaluating listed expressions on a benchmark-relative basis. It contains no position sizing, no price targets and no trade recommendations. The scope is listed Indian scheduled commercial banks β€” the domestic systemically important banks, the private challengers, the small finance banks and the public sector banks β€” with deliberate comparison to Brazil, the United States and Japan. Standalone non-bank lenders, pure asset managers, payment aggregators and insurers sit outside the boundary, appearing only where they supply, distribute for, or compete with a bank balance sheet.

The governing distinction throughout: a correct forecast about a society can still produce a poor security outcome, because the analyst chose the wrong layer of the value chain, the wrong company within that layer, or the right company at the wrong price. India's financialization could unfold exactly as described and still leave a portfolio of Indian bank equities underwater, if the profits are competed away, regulated away, or already embedded in the multiple.

What would prove us wrong

The upstream belief has three named falsifiers, stated here before the evidence so the article reads as a test rather than an argument.

If currency in circulation as a share of GDP rises above 12.5% for two consecutive fiscal years, Indians are moving back to cash and the shadow economy is reasserting itself; as of mid-2026 that ratio remained contained, around 11.5%.4 If household net financial capital formation falls durably below 5.0% of GDP, real incomes are not generating the savings the thesis requires. And if credit costs on digitally underwritten retail portfolios exceed 3.5% annually across a full 24-month cycle, then cash-flow underwriting has delivered faster lending rather than better risk selection.

Digitisation has removed the friction from finding and underwriting a borrower. That is the easy half. Removing friction on the asset side of a bank's balance sheet only sharpens the fight on the other side, where the money to lend has to come from. That fight is the central economic story of Indian banking in 2026.

2. The Tech Foundation: India Stack, UPI, and Account Aggregators Demolishing the Underwriting Gate

For most of the history of commercial banking, lending to a small borrower has been governed by what credit officers call the three Cs: collateral, character and capacity. Of the three, collateral did nearly all the work, because it was the only one that could be verified cheaply. Character required a relationship. Capacity required accounts. Collateral required a document and a valuer.

The consequence was a country-sized filter. If a borrower's wealth sat in forms the formal system could not perfect a charge over β€” a rented shopfront, inventory, a family's gold, an unregistered plot β€” that borrower was unbankable at any price, and went to a moneylender at rates that made the comparison academic.

A useful way to describe what changed: traditional underwriting took a single static photograph of a borrower's assets, perhaps once every five years, and lent against the photograph. Account Aggregator-based underwriting streams continuous video of the borrower's cash inflows and outflows. The lender sees seasonality, concentration, volatility, and β€” most valuable of all β€” the moment things start to go wrong, months before a payment is missed.

The analogy has a limit worth stating immediately, because the limit is where the credit losses live. Video of a bank account is not video of a business. It shows the flows that pass through the formal system and is blind to the ones that do not, which in an economy still partly informal can be a large share. It shows a borrower's receipts but not the three other lenders who saw the same receipts and lent against them the same week. And it can be gamed: circular transfers between related accounts can manufacture the appearance of turnover. Cash-flow data improves the selection of borrowers dramatically. It does not, on its own, solve leverage stacking or fraud, and both of those are where digital lending goes to die.

The four layers

India's digital public infrastructure is best understood as four stacked layers, each of which removed a specific cost from the lending process.

The identity layer came first. Aadhaar-based electronic know-your-customer verification collapsed onboarding cost from several hundred rupees of paperwork, courier and manual verification to a figure practitioners put in the low double digits per account. That is what made the Jan Dhan expansion economically survivable; opening 520 million accounts at β‚Ή600 apiece would have been a β‚Ή31,000-crore act of charity.5

The payments layer β€” UPI, operated by the National Payments Corporation of India β€” did something more subtle than displace cash. It made small-value economic activity legible. A merchant who accepts payment digitally generates an audit trail as a by-product of doing business, without filing anything. By early 2026 the system was running at over 15.2 billion transactions a month.1 What matters to a lender is less the volume than the consequence: a previously invisible category of borrower now arrives pre-documented.

The data empowerment layer is the Account Aggregator framework, coordinated through the industry body Sahamati. It is a consent-based protocol: a borrower authorises a specific lender to pull specific data for a specific period from banks, the goods-and-services-tax network, and other financial information providers. The aggregator itself is a blind pipe β€” it moves encrypted data and cannot read it. Cumulative linked accounts crossed 110 million, with monthly consent volumes running near 12.5 million by mid-2026.2

The credit protocol layer β€” the Open Credit Enablement Network, or OCEN β€” is the least mature and the most consequential. It standardises the APIs of loan origination itself, so that any application with a customer relationship can present a credit offer at the point of need, with a regulated lender's balance sheet behind it. We will return to why this is the single largest structural threat to bank economics in this story.

Comparisons to European open banking are natural and partly misleading. Under Europe's second Payment Services Directive, banks were compelled to expose customer data to licensed third parties, and adoption was slow and litigated, partly because the incumbents supplying the data competed with the parties consuming it and had every incentive to keep the pipes narrow. India's design differs: the aggregator is a neutral, non-monetising intermediary on a common standard, and the incentive to obstruct is weaker because the same institution is usually both provider and consumer on different transactions. The limit of the comparison matters too. European open banking operated where credit bureaus were already deep and income documentation universal, so an API added little information. In India it adds an enormous amount, which is why the same protocol produces a much larger effect.

Who built what, and who is renting it

ICICI Bank is the clearest architectural protagonist among the large lenders. Its iMobile Pay application was opened to customers of other banks β€” unusual for an institution whose historic advantage was its own customer list β€” and had drawn more than 12 million non-ICICI users by FY26, working as a low-cost acquisition funnel into lending products.8 The financial signature showed up in FY26 as a cost-to-income ratio near 39.2% and return on assets around 2.38%, the highest among large Indian banks.8

Federal Bank, a mid-sized Kerala-headquartered lender, took the opposite route to the same rail. Rather than build a consumer super-app, it became the regulated balance sheet behind consumer-facing fintech applications including Fi, Jupiter and OneCard.9 The trade is deliberate: the fintech owns the relationship and the interface, Federal owns the deposit, the licence and the credit risk, and earns a spread it could not have bought that cheaply through its own branches. It works up to a point β€” FY26 return on assets of roughly 1.28% sat well below the large private banks, on a structurally lower margin near 3.18%.9 Renting distribution costs less than owning it and pays less.

Behind both models sits an unglamorous engineering fact. Core banking systems built in the 1990s and 2000s assumed a customer who transacted a handful of times a month. UPI turned that customer into one who transacts several times a day at values under β‚Ή100, while the same systems field real-time balance enquiries and settlement postings at national scale. The vendors supplying these platforms β€” Infosys with Finacle, Tata Consultancy Services with TCS BaNCS, Oracle with Flexcube β€” had to re-architect throughput and availability rather than features. Section 7 walks that supply chain properly.

What the digital rail is worth, in basis points

The investable claim here is narrow and measurable. Digital origination lowers two costs and one of them is contested.

Operating cost is the uncontested one. Technology-forward private banks now run cost-to-income ratios in the high thirties to low forties, against a historical system norm above 50%.4 For a bank with a 3.5% margin structure, a ten-point improvement in cost-to-income is worth roughly 30–40 basis points of pre-tax return on assets β€” enormous in an industry where the whole spread between an excellent bank and a mediocre one is about 100 basis points of RoA.

Credit cost is contested. The bull argument is that continuous cash-flow visibility plus near-universal bureau coverage structurally lowers loss rates, because lenders select better and intervene earlier. The bear argument, which has evidence behind it, is that Account Aggregator consent skews toward prime borrowers who already had documented income, so the marginal information gain is smallest exactly where the credit risk is largest β€” the informal, thin-file borrower the thesis is supposedly about.

A live empirical dispute sits inside this. Fintech lenders claim their machine-learning models underwrite personal loans better than bank scorecards; credit bureau data shows materially higher multi-lender stacking among borrowers sourced through fintech channels, the same individual holding several small unsecured loans from lenders each of whom could see the bureau file but priced as though they were alone.7 Both can be true β€” a model can rank risk well within its own applicant pool and still lend into a systemically over-levered cohort. The Reserve Bank took the second view and acted on it.

The share of retail and MSME originations flowing through Account Aggregator consent rails β€” roughly 15.2% by value in mid-2026 β€” is the cleanest single measure of whether the underwriting revolution is real or rhetorical, and one of the four crux indicators this article returns to at the end.2

Origination, then, is close to a solved problem. Which raises the question of what is being originated with. A bank cannot lend a data stream. It lends money borrowed from depositors, and in 2026 India ran short of them.

3. The Binding Constraint: The Credit-to-Deposit Gap and the War for Liabilities

Consider the arithmetic in front of the asset-liability committee of any fast-growing Indian private bank in 2026. Loans are compounding between 13% and 17%. Deposits are growing around 10%. Both cannot continue. The bank has three moves: raise deposit rates and give up margin, buy wholesale funding and give up margin and liquidity comfort, or slow lending and give up share and the growth multiple attached to it. There is no fourth move; the regulator will not permit one. This is the binding constraint of the entire theme, and the reason returns will not distribute evenly across the institutions participating in it.

Exhibit 1 β€” Indian scheduled commercial banks: credit growth vs deposit growth, FY2021–FY2026 Definition: year-on-year growth in outstanding non-food credit and aggregate deposits of scheduled commercial banks, as at end-March of each fiscal year; credit-to-deposit ratio is outstanding credit divided by outstanding deposits. Units: per cent. Geography: all-India. Source: Reserve Bank of India, Weekly Statistical Supplement and sectoral credit deployment data. Evidence status: observed official data.

Fiscal year (end-March) Credit growth (YoY %) Deposit growth (YoY %) Credit-to-deposit ratio (%)
FY2021 5.6 11.4 71.5
FY2022 9.6 8.9 72.0
FY2023 15.0 9.6 75.8
FY2024 16.3 12.9 78.1
FY2025 13.5 10.8 79.2
FY2026 12.0 9.8 79.5

Read that table aloud and the story tells itself. In FY2021, in the depths of the pandemic, deposits grew twice as fast as loans β€” households hoarded, banks parked the surplus with the central bank, and the ratio fell to 71.5%.10 Then the recovery arrived: credit ran at 15–16% for two years while deposits struggled to reach 13% in the best year of the cycle. Every year since FY2022 loans have outgrown deposits, ratcheting the ratio up about eight points to 79.5%. In FY2026 the gap was 2.2 percentage points β€” undramatic in any single year, and compounded across five it has consumed the system's entire liquidity cushion.

Why the deposits went missing

The intuitive explanation β€” that Indians stopped saving β€” is wrong, and getting it wrong leads to the wrong conclusion about whether the problem self-corrects. Household financial savings recovered.4 What changed is where they went.

The same formalization that fed banks their borrowers handed households an alternative to bank deposits. A saver who ten years ago chose between a fixed deposit and gold now chooses between a fixed deposit, a systematic investment plan executed from a phone in ninety seconds, a sovereign gold bond and a direct equity account. A large part of the β‚Ή24,000 crore a month flowing into SIPs is money that would previously have sat, sullenly, in a savings account at 3%.6 The banking system built the rails that disintermediated its own cheapest funding.

Real deposit rates did the rest. For much of 2022–2026 savings account rates sat below inflation, term deposits offered a thin real return, and the tax treatment of interest income compared unfavourably with capital gains on equity funds for exactly the affluent urban saver a private bank most wants.

The regulator tightens the same screw

The Reserve Bank of India then did something that made the constraint harder rather than softer, and understanding why is essential to understanding the sector.

Under draft liquidity coverage ratio guidelines circulated in 2024 and refined through 2026, the RBI proposed raising the assumed run-off factor on retail deposits linked to internet and mobile banking from 5% to 10%.4 The logic is uncomfortable and correct. A depositor who must visit a branch to withdraw is a slow depositor. A depositor with a banking app can move an entire balance to a competitor in under a minute, at three in the morning, on the basis of a rumour. Deposit runs in the digital era are faster than any liquidity buffer sized on twentieth-century assumptions.

The consequence is direct. A higher assumed run-off requires more high-quality liquid assets β€” government securities yielding less than loans β€” against the same deposit base. Industry estimates put the margin cost at roughly 8–15 basis points, though bank-by-bank impact depends on how digital deposits are classified in final rules not fully settled at the time of writing.11 The banks most affected are the technology-forward private lenders whose whole strategic story is that their deposits are mobile-first. The regulation taxes the thing the theme celebrates.

Three banks, three positions in the same war

HDFC Bank created its own constraint. The 2023 merger of its parent, the mortgage lender HDFC Ltd, into the bank produced a combined balance sheet above β‚Ή38 lakh crore and one of the ten largest banks in the world by assets.12 It also imported a roughly $60 billion loan book funded largely by wholesale borrowings rather than deposits, pushing the merged credit-to-deposit ratio to around 100% against a pre-merger norm near 85%. Everything since has been organised around one objective: growing deposits fast enough to bring that ratio down without shrinking the loan book. In FY26 the bank reported advances near β‚Ή25.2 lakh crore against deposits of about β‚Ή23.8 lakh crore, with deposits growing 14.4% against advances of 12.0% β€” deliberately running assets slower than liabilities, and adding upwards of β‚Ή3 lakh crore of deposits a year.12 The cost shows in a net interest margin of about 3.45%, well below what a bank of its quality historically earned.12

State Bank of India sits on the other side of the same war and barely feels it. SBI held roughly β‚Ή50.2 lakh crore of deposits in FY26 β€” about 23% of the entire Indian system β€” with a current-and-savings-account ratio near 41%.13 Its cost of funds is structurally lower than any private competitor's because a substantial share of its deposits arrive not through pricing but through mandate and habit: government salary accounts, defence and public-sector payrolls, pension distribution, tax collection. When the price of deposits rises, SBI's competitors bid. SBI mostly does not have to.

IDFC First Bank is the challenger paying full retail price for its funding. It grew customer deposits about 26% year on year in FY26 against advances growth of 21%, with retail deposits above 78% of the total β€” an unusually high-quality mix by composition.14 It bought that mix by offering savings and term rates at the top of the market and by building branches, which is why its cost-to-income ratio sat near 69.5% and its return on assets near 1.15% despite a headline net interest margin of about 6.10%.14 IDFC First demonstrates the central asymmetry of this industry: high margins earned on expensive deposits and costly distribution are not the same asset as ordinary margins earned on cheap deposits.

Three worlds forward

The scenarios worth holding are causal paths, not percentage adjustments.

In the bear world, inflation proves stickier than expected, the RBI holds or raises policy rates above 7.25%, and households keep preferring real assets and equities to deposits. Deposit growth settles at 7.5–8.5% while credit demand persists, driving the system ratio through 85%. Banks bid for bulk and term money; cost of funds rises faster than loan yields reprice; top-tier private margins compress into a 3.10–3.35% band, and credit costs rise as unsecured vintages season into a weaker income environment. Private-bank returns on assets fall toward 1.2% and public-sector banks toward 0.6%. The winners are the institutions that never needed to bid; the losers are high-credit-to-deposit private banks without branch density.

In the base world, deposit growth accelerates modestly as real incomes improve and the RBI eases reserve requirements, credit compounds at 12–13.5% β€” roughly 1.2 times nominal GDP growth β€” and deposits catch up to 11–12%. Margins hold at 3.65–4.10% for top private lenders, system gross NPAs stay near 2.0% and credit costs near 0.6%, with private RoA about 1.9% and public-sector RoA about 1.1%. The technology-efficient large private banks compound book value in the mid-to-high teens and the sector performs approximately as priced.

In the bull world, deposit growth breaks 14% as formalization pulls new savers in, credit runs at 15.5–17%, and the cost and credit-cost savings from cash-flow underwriting arrive in full. Margins expand to 4.30–4.65% for the best-positioned lenders, credit costs fall to 0.35%, and private RoA reaches 2.5%. High-yield challengers with operating leverage still to harvest outperform, because their earnings are geared to cost ratios that have furthest to fall.

Notice which variable discriminates between the three worlds. Credit demand is present in all of them; what varies is the supply of deposits. In modern Indian banking, asset creation has become a technology problem that is largely solved. Liability gathering remains a zero-sum contest over a pool that grows only as fast as household savings allow.

The next question is what that contest is actually worth. How large is the profit pool being fought over, and where does it come from?

4. The Profit-Pool Waterfall: From β‚Ή320 Lakh Cr GDP to the β‚Ή3 Lakh Cr Bank Profit Engine

Follow a single rupee of Indian economic activity down to a bank shareholder and you learn more about this industry than any ratio can teach. The journey passes through nine drains, and at the end roughly one paisa in a hundred of national output survives as bank net profit.

India's nominal GDP in FY26 ran above β‚Ή320 lakh crore β€” approximately $4.1 trillion.4 A portion of the income it generates is saved in financial form, pooling into the system deposit base of roughly β‚Ή215 lakh crore.10 That is the raw material of the industry, and everything downstream depends on how much of it a bank attracts and at what price.

The first drain is the regulator's, and it happens before a bank can lend a rupee. Indian banks must hold a non-interest-bearing cash reserve ratio with the central bank and a statutory liquidity ratio in government securities. Together these lock up roughly 22–23% of deposits, on the order of β‚Ή48 lakh crore, in instruments yielding materially less than loans.4 Economically this is a compulsory low-return asset allocation that dilutes the return on every deposit raised β€” which is why the marginal deposit is worth less than the headline lending spread suggests, and why the deposit war hurts more than it looks.

What remains is a deployable credit pool of about β‚Ή170 lakh crore. Lent across retail mortgages, auto and personal loans, credit cards, MSME working capital, corporate term lending and trade finance, and combined with fee income from third-party distribution, transaction banking and treasury, this generates a gross interest and fee income pool of roughly β‚Ή19.5 lakh crore.

Now the drains resume. Interest paid to depositors and wholesale lenders consumes about β‚Ή11.2 lakh crore β€” the single largest line in the industry, and the one the deposit war inflates. Operating expenses, meaning salaries, branch leases, technology and marketing, take about β‚Ή3.8 lakh crore.

What survives is pre-provision operating profit of roughly β‚Ή4.5 lakh crore. This is the number that matters most in bank analysis, because it is the earnings the bank generates before deciding how much to admit about its loan losses. Provisions absorb about β‚Ή0.8 lakh crore at the current credit cost of 0.5–0.6%, which is a multi-decade low. And the residue is the system net profit pool of β‚Ή2.8–3.1 lakh crore, roughly $34–37 billion.4

Two things about that figure deserve emphasis. It is unusually large relative to history because the provisioning line is unusually small β€” at FY2018 credit costs the same pre-provision profit would have produced a fraction of the net profit, and in several years none. Any analysis extrapolating 2026 credit costs indefinitely is extrapolating the best conditions in fifteen years. And the pool is being fought over by institutions with very different claims on it.

Exhibit 2 β€” Indian banking system market share by ownership group, 2026 Definition: share of aggregate scheduled commercial bank deposits and credit outstanding by ownership group. Units: per cent of system total. Geography: all-India. Period: as at 2026. Source: Reserve Bank of India, Handbook of Statistics on the Indian Economy and Financial Stability Report.4 Evidence status: observed official data.

Ownership group Share of system deposits (%) Share of system credit (%)
Public sector banks 57.5 53.2
Private sector banks 37.2 41.8
Small finance and foreign banks 5.3 5.0

The gap between the two columns is the whole competitive story in two numbers. Public sector banks hold 57.5% of deposits but only 53.2% of credit β€” they gather more money than they lend, and the surplus flows into government securities and the interbank market. Private banks hold 37.2% of deposits and 41.8% of credit β€” they lend more than they gather, and fund the difference by paying up. Now compare that to profits: public sector banks capture roughly 42% of system net profit while holding nearly 58% of deposits, and listed private banks capture roughly 52% of net profit on 37% of deposits. Private lenders convert every rupee of deposits into about 1.9 times as much profit as their public-sector counterparts, on returns on assets of 1.8–2.4% against 1.0–1.2%.

That gap has a cost explanation and a mix explanation. On cost, public sector banks run cost-to-income in the high forties to low fifties β€” State Bank of India reported about 52.8% in FY26 against ICICI Bank's 39.2% β€” driven by wage settlements, pension liabilities and a branch estate sized for a pre-digital country.138 On mix, private banks skew toward higher-yielding retail and MSME assets, while public sector banks carry more corporate and infrastructure credit priced off benchmark rates at thin spreads, plus a heavier priority sector lending burden they cannot always meet profitably.

That last point is a regulatory transfer that shows up nowhere in the headline ratios. Indian banks must direct 40% of adjusted net bank credit to priority sectors β€” agriculture, MSMEs, affordable housing, weaker sections β€” with shortfalls parked in NABARD's Rural Infrastructure Development Fund at low yields.4 For a bank with a natural franchise in those segments the mandate is costless; for one whose customers are urban and affluent it is a tax collected in basis points, through underpriced lending or through the RIDF penalty box. Indian bank margins therefore cannot be compared naively with those in unmandated markets.

Where the profit pool has moved

Two migrations have reshaped who earns what.

The first ran from wholesale corporate lending to granular retail and MSME credit. In 2015 corporate credit contributed above 60% of the large banks' lending profit; by 2026 that share had fallen below 30%. The move was forced rather than chosen. Corporate lending destroyed an extraordinary amount of capital in the 2015–2019 cycle, and the survivors rebuilt around assets that were smaller, more numerous, better diversified and 200 to 400 basis points higher-yielding on a risk-adjusted basis.

The second migration is still under way: from pure interest spread toward a fee stack. As margins normalise, the best Indian banks increasingly earn from distributing other people's products β€” mutual funds, insurance, wealth management β€” and from transaction banking and trade finance. ICICI Bank and Kotak Mahindra Bank have pushed non-interest income above 28% of total income.815 Axis Bank made the most explicit purchase of a fee pool, acquiring Citigroup's India consumer business and roughly three million affluent card and wealth clients, lifting its credit card share to around 14%.16 Fee income is worth more than its rupee value suggests because it consumes almost no capital: a rupee of commission requires no risk weighting, no provisioning and no deposit to fund it.

The reinvestment problem nobody puts in the pitch

Here is where bank analysis diverges from ordinary industrial analysis, and where thematic investors most often get hurt.

A bank's reported profit is not distributable cash. Growth consumes capital at a fixed ratio: to grow risk-weighted assets 14%, a bank must grow equity roughly 14%, which means retaining most of what it earns. Indian banks in this cycle retain on the order of 70–80% of earnings simply to fund 13–15% credit growth. A bank earning 17% on equity and growing loans 14% returns very little to shareholders in cash; the return arrives as compounding book value, and converts to shareholder value only if the market keeps paying a premium to book.

The corollary is sharp. The fastest-growing banks in this theme are the likeliest to need external equity. IDFC First Bank, growing advances above 20% on a 1.15% return on assets, generates internal capital of roughly 10–11% against balance-sheet growth above 20%.14 The gap closes through dilution. Kotak Mahindra Bank has the opposite problem: capital adequacy above 20.5% and Tier-1 above 19% means excess capital earning a low return, one reason its 14.5% return on equity understates the underlying business.15

One arithmetic consistency test is worth running on the sector's collective ambitions. If the system grows credit at 12% while every large private bank plans 14–17% and the small finance banks plan 24%, public sector banks must grow at 9–10% and cede two to three points of credit share a year. Some of that is happening. Sustained for five years it would require public sector banks to accept it β€” and they are recapitalised by a government that also sets their growth targets. Not every private bank's plan can be right.

The profit pool, in short, is large, has migrated toward the private lenders, and is currently flattered by the lowest credit costs in fifteen years. Whether that last condition is a structural achievement or the top of a cycle is the most important open question in the sector β€” and answering it means going back to the wreck.

5. Capital Cycles, AQR Scars, and the Structural vs. Cyclical Divide

In 2015 the Reserve Bank of India, under Governor Raghuram Rajan, began an Asset Quality Review. The mechanism was simple and merciless: supervisors identified specific borrower accounts across the system and instructed every bank with exposure to classify them consistently. A loan that one bank was carrying as standard while another had recognised it as stressed could no longer be carried as standard.

What that surfaced was a decade of accumulated fiction. Loans to steel producers, thermal power projects, road developers and infrastructure holding companies β€” extended during the 2007–2011 capex boom on the assumption that Indian growth would validate almost any project β€” had stopped performing years earlier and had been kept alive through restructuring, refinancing and forbearance. System gross NPAs went from around 4.3% to 11.5% at the FY2018 peak.4 Over β‚Ή10 lakh crore of credit was reclassified as impaired. Public sector bank equity was substantially wiped out and replaced by the government. System return on equity fell below 4%.

Causation matters here. The AQR did not create the bad loans; it revealed them, and in doing so achieved something no Indian regulator had previously managed β€” it made the losses simultaneous, forcing them to be dealt with together rather than rolled forward one bank at a time. The Insolvency and Bankruptcy Code, enacted in 2016, then gave lenders a resolution mechanism with a clock on it. Together the two interventions ended evergreening as a systemic strategy.

Exhibit 3 β€” Indian banking system asset quality, FY2018–FY2026 Definition: gross non-performing assets and net non-performing assets as a percentage of gross advances for all scheduled commercial banks; provision coverage ratio is specific provisions held against gross NPAs. Units: per cent. Geography: all-India. Period: fiscal years ending March. Source: Reserve Bank of India, Financial Stability Reports. Evidence status: observed official data.

Fiscal year Gross NPA (%) Net NPA (%) Provision coverage ratio (%)
FY2018 (AQR peak) 11.5 6.1 52.4
FY2020 8.2 2.8 65.1
FY2022 5.8 1.7 70.9
FY2024 2.8 0.6 76.4
FY2025 2.3 0.5 78.2
FY2026 2.1 0.4 79.5

Three lines, three separate improvements, and the third is the one most investors skip. Gross NPAs fell from 11.5% to 2.1% β€” a scale of repair few banking systems have achieved outside a sovereign crisis. Net NPAs fell further and faster, from 6.1% to 0.4%, which shows banks provisioning rather than borrowers merely curing. And provision coverage rose from 52.4% to 79.5%, meaning that for every rupee of admitted bad loan, Indian banks now hold nearly eighty paise of provisions against it.4 Alongside this, system capital adequacy stood at 17.2–17.4% against a regulatory requirement of 11.5%.4 By any historical standard, this is the cleanest and best-capitalised the Indian banking system has ever been.

Which is precisely why it deserves suspicion.

Reading the capital cycle

Bank capital cycles run in recognisable stages, and knowing which stage you are in matters more than any individual bank's quality.

Stage one, crisis and purge, 2015–2018. Forced recognition, provisioning surges, credit costs above 3.5%, equity destruction, and a collapse in the supply of credit as banks conserved capital. Public sector banks stopped lending to industry almost entirely.

Stage two, cleanup and consolidation, 2019–2022. Write-offs, state recapitalisation, and the merger of ten public sector banks into four larger entities. Strategy across the whole industry pivoted away from corporate capex toward retail lending β€” partly because retail was genuinely more profitable, and partly because everyone had just watched corporate lending destroy their peers.

Stage three, harvest, 2023–2026. Loss rates at multi-decade lows, capital abundant, returns on equity restored to 14–19% for the better institutions, and credit growth running well above nominal GDP for the first sustained period since the previous boom.

The uncomfortable historical observation is that stage three manufactures the next stage one. Capital cycles in banking turn not because banks make obviously bad loans but because they make ordinary loans at extraordinary volume into a segment untested through a downturn. The retail and MSME books built in India in 2023–2026 have never seen a serious unemployment shock, a monsoon failure combined with rural income stress, or a genuine property price correction. The credit costs in Exhibit 3 are real, and they are the credit costs of an untested vintage.

Separating what is permanent from what is passing

The single most useful discipline in this sector is sorting the forces into the ones that survive a cycle and the ones that do not.

Structural, and permanent: Account Aggregator adoption and the shift from collateral-based to cash-flow-based underwriting. The integration of the goods-and-services-tax database, which gave lenders a verifiable revenue signal for every registered business. Bureau coverage at 440 million individuals, which makes leverage stacking visible in a way it never was.7 The cash-to-digital transition in payments. And the regulatory architecture itself β€” higher risk weights on unsecured consumer credit, and the move to expected credit loss provisioning β€” which permanently changes how much capital a given loan consumes.

Cyclical, and temporary: the elevated credit-to-deposit ratio, the current round of deposit rate competition, net interest margin compression, short-term stress in unsecured retail vintages, and the policy rate cycle itself. These will oscillate. They matter enormously to two-year earnings and very little to ten-year value.

Two regulatory items sit awkwardly across the line. The expected credit loss framework β€” the move from provisioning after a default to provisioning for expected losses at origination, under Ind-AS 109 β€” is structural in effect but produces a one-time cyclical hit on transition. Banks with provision coverage already above 75–80% face modest capital impact; under-provisioned lenders face a real equity charge. Estimates of the transition cost range from 20 to 80 basis points of Tier-1 capital depending on the balance sheet, and the effective implementation date has itself been debated between FY26 and FY27.11 The honest position is that the framework's direction is certain and its timing and calibration are not.

The draft liquidity coverage ratio norms are the other. They are structural in that digital deposits genuinely are flightier than branch deposits and always will be. They are cyclical in that the final calibration is a negotiation.

Two banks that show what the cycle did

Punjab National Bank is the clearest expression of pure cyclical repair. It carried gross NPAs above 14% at the worst of the cycle; by 2026 that had fallen to around 4.2%, with provision coverage above 80%.17 Its return on assets of about 0.78% and net interest margin near 2.92% remain the weakest among the large listed banks, and its operating efficiency lags peers.17 What PNB owns is the second-largest branch network in India and a large, sticky, low-cost deposit base across the northern agrarian belt. What it has not yet demonstrated is the ability to convert that liability advantage into competitive returns. It trades at roughly 0.85 times adjusted book value, which is the market saying, reasonably, that it will believe the recovery when the earnings persist through a full cycle rather than through a benign one.

Bank of Baroda cleaned up faster and further. Gross NPAs of about 2.25%, provision coverage near 77.5%, return on assets holding above 1.0%, return on equity of roughly 16.1%, and a dividend yield near 4.5% β€” an unusual combination in a growth market.18 Its constraint is operational rather than financial: regulatory scrutiny of governance around its digital onboarding platform interrupted the customer acquisition engine at exactly the moment when digital acquisition became the main determinant of deposit growth. A public sector bank that cannot onboard digitally in 2026 is competing with one hand tied.

The system, then, enters the second half of this decade with the cleanest balance sheet in a generation, the best capitalisation on record, and a credit loss experience that is almost certainly better than the cycle-average it will eventually revert to. That combination sets up a competitive contest in which the participants are playing genuinely different games.

6. The Competitive Field & Parameter-Specific Leadership: Sovereign Moats, Tech Engines, and Micro-Yield Extractors

There is no single leader in Indian banking. There are leaders on specific parameters, for specific customers, in specific geographies, measured at specific dates β€” and the parameters point in different directions.

Three institutions make the point. State Bank of India operates from Nariman Point in Mumbai, an address that dates its lineage to the era when it was the government's bank. ICICI Bank operates from the Bandra Kurla Complex, the financial district built in the 2000s. AU Small Finance Bank is headquartered in Jaipur, because its customers are there. Each is winning at something the others are not seriously contesting.

Leadership on deposit scale and cost: State Bank of India

The parameter: total deposit franchise and cost of funds across all customer segments in India, as at Q4 FY26. The closest rival: HDFC Bank. SBI held approximately β‚Ή50.2 lakh crore in deposits, about 23% of the system, with a CASA ratio near 41% β€” four in every ten rupees sitting in accounts paying near-zero or low single-digit interest.13 HDFC Bank, the largest private bank, held about β‚Ή23.8 lakh crore, less than half.12

Why customers care: mostly they do not, consciously β€” which is the point. The advantage is inherited through institutional position rather than earned through product superiority. Why SBI leads rather than its rivals: the bank's lineage runs through the Imperial Bank of India and its nationalisation in 1955, which made it the default banking counterparty of the Indian state. Salary accounts for government employees, defence personnel and public sector undertaking staff default to SBI, and tax collection and pension disbursement flow through it. Layer on 22,500-plus branches in places where no private bank can justify the fixed cost, and you have a liability franchise that strategy did not build and strategy cannot dismantle.

Durability: high, with one qualification. The moat is a cornered resource β€” sovereign relationship plus rural physical presence β€” rather than a capability, which makes it exceptionally hard to copy and equally hard to extend. SBI cannot use its deposit advantage to win affluent urban wealth management, and its 52.8% cost-to-income ratio shows what happens when a network built for one purpose competes on another.13 Its YONO application, with over 75 million registered users generating more than 65% of digital retail originations, is the attempt to convert scale into digital efficiency; it works at the origination layer and has not yet moved the cost base.13 The one thing on the visible horizon that could erase the moat is a central bank digital currency letting households hold balances directly with the RBI, treated in Section 9.

Leadership on digital architecture and return on assets: ICICI Bank

The parameter: return on assets among large Indian banks, and the digital origination architecture producing it, as at Q4 FY26. The closest rival: Axis Bank. ICICI reported return on assets of about 2.38%, net interest margin of 4.25%, cost-to-income of 39.2% and gross NPAs of 1.40%; Axis reported 1.78%, 3.95%, 48.5% and 1.35%.816 Both are excellent banks, and the nine-point cost-to-income gap between them converts almost entirely into the 60-basis-point RoA gap.

Why customers care: approval speed and pricing, both of which follow from the architecture. A bank that underwrites from cash-flow data in minutes wins the customer who needs money this week.

Why ICICI leads: the answer is a reversal rather than a strategy document. ICICI was among the most damaged large private banks in the 2015–2018 corporate credit cycle. The rebuild reorganised the institution around risk-calibrated core operating profit rather than loan growth, and β€” the genuinely unusual decision β€” opened its digital front end to non-customers, accepting that much of the traffic would remain other banks' depositors. More than 12 million non-ICICI users on iMobile Pay is a customer acquisition machine with almost no marginal cost, feeding an automated risk-pricing engine, and retail and business banking now account for more than 68% of the loan book.8

Durability: high but not permanent. The capability is process power β€” accumulated skill in shipping digital products and pricing risk β€” hard to copy because it takes a decade of consistent management, and vulnerable to management change or to a competitor buying the same capability. Axis is the live test: it acquired Citi India's consumer franchise to obtain a segment and a fee stack it could not build organically.

Leadership on margin quality: a contested claim worth unpacking

The dossier framing that Kotak Mahindra Bank leads on net interest margin maximisation, with IDFC First Bank as challenger, is worth examining because on the raw number it is false. IDFC First reported a net interest margin near 6.10%; Kotak reported 4.80%.1415 Ranked on the headline metric, IDFC First wins by a mile.

Ranked on anything that reaches a shareholder, it does not. IDFC First converted its 6.10% margin into a return on assets of 1.15% and a return on equity of 10.8%. Kotak converted 4.80% into 2.15% RoA. The 130-basis-point margin advantage evaporated inside a cost-to-income ratio of 69.5% versus 46.8%, and inside a credit cost structure appropriate to high-yield unsecured and consumer-durable lending.1415

This is the most important comparability lesson in Indian bank analysis. Net interest margin measures gross revenue, not profitability. A high margin can mean pricing power, or it can mean lending to riskier borrowers with expensive money through an expensive network. Comparing NIM across banks with different asset mixes, funding structures and cost bases produces false rankings. The defensible statement is narrower: Kotak Mahindra Bank leads on margin converted to return on assets among mid-sized-to-large Indian private banks as at Q4 FY26, with capital adequacy above 20.5% and Tier-1 above 19% β€” the highest capitalisation in the peer set.15

Why Kotak leads: the institution grew out of a non-bank finance company and retains that heritage's instinct that a loan's price must compensate for its risk regardless of the volume implied, repeatedly declining segments where it judged pricing inadequate. The capital position is the visible artefact of that discipline. The vulnerability is real: Kotak operated under Reserve Bank restrictions arising from a technology audit, which constrained digital onboarding precisely when digital onboarding determined deposit growth. With leadership transition alongside, this de-rated the stock from roughly 3.5 times adjusted book to about 2.1 times.15 Excess capital is worth little until it can be deployed, and it cannot be deployed at scale without customer acquisition.

Leadership on semi-urban and MSME yield extraction: AU Small Finance Bank

The parameter: risk-adjusted yield on self-employed, semi-urban and small-business lending in northern and western India, as at Q4 FY26. The closest rival: IndusInd Bank, in adjacent vehicle-finance and microfinance segments. AU reported net interest margin near 5.50%, advances growth of about 24% and deposit growth of 28%, on an advances base near β‚Ή0.95 lakh crore; IndusInd, roughly three and a half times larger in advances, reported a 4.18% margin and 1.72% RoA.319

Why AU leads: domain underwriting that predates the digital rails. AU spent years as a vehicle and equipment financier lending to self-employed borrowers with no formal income documentation, where collateral was mobile and reputation was local. That produced underwriting heuristics and a field collection organisation that a large bank's centralised scorecard does not replicate; the India Stack made the capability cheaper to deploy rather than obsolete.

Durability: medium, and the risks are specific. AU is transitioning toward a universal banking licence, which if granted would lower its cost of funds β€” a 25-basis-point reduction is worth roughly β‚Ή280 crore of pre-tax profit at current scale β€” while simultaneously digesting the merger of Fincare Small Finance Bank and its differently shaped microfinance portfolio.3 At roughly 2.7 times adjusted book, the premium assumes both the licence and the integration go well.3

The rest of the field, and what each one is actually for

Federal Bank holds a genuinely differentiated position as regulated infrastructure behind consumer fintech applications, alongside a non-resident Indian deposit franchise worth about 18% of its liabilities β€” sticky, low-cost money sourced from the Gulf through relationships built over decades in Kerala.9 The economics are honest about themselves: a 3.18% margin and 1.28% RoA at roughly 1.3 times book.9 Its vulnerability is regulatory rather than commercial β€” if the RBI tightens rules on fintech co-lending or first-loss default guarantee arrangements, the partner-bank model's economics change overnight, and Federal has more exposure to that than any listed peer.

IndusInd Bank is a domain specialist in commercial vehicle finance β€” roughly 12% market share β€” and microfinance, both high-yield and highly cyclical.19 It reported a 4.18% margin and 1.72% RoA at roughly 1.5 times book, against a historical peak near 2.8 times.19 The discount reflects microfinance loss volatility, which spikes with rural distress and monsoon failure, and long-running questions about promoter holding structure. A 50-basis-point reduction in microfinance credit cost would add roughly β‚Ή700 crore to net profit β€” the mathematical statement of how much of this equity is a bet on rural weather and rural income.19

Below the large names sits a tier of regional lenders that will not lead anything nationally. City Union Bank lends working capital to small manufacturers and traders in Tamil Nadu on relationships built across generations of family businesses; Karur Vysya Bank runs a similar southern SME book with a disciplined asset quality record; Karnataka Bank is executing a slower repair from a weaker starting position. Each is a legitimate business bounded by its geography, and none is a vehicle for the national digitisation theme, because their advantage is precisely the local knowledge the digital rails commoditise.

Among the small finance banks beyond AU, Equitas Small Finance Bank built a book in micro-mortgages and small commercial vehicle finance, Ujjivan Small Finance Bank came out of microfinance and is diversifying into individual retail loans, and Bandhan Bank is the largest expression of the microfinance model, concentrated in eastern India. All three share one structural problem: a small finance bank pays more for deposits than a universal bank, competes for the same borrowers, and lacks the scale to absorb a credit shock without a capital event. The premium multiples this cohort once commanded β€” above 3.5 times book, on assumptions of uncapped high-yield growth β€” compressed as those economics asserted themselves.

The competitive map, then: SBI owns the sovereign deposit base, ICICI owns digital risk-pricing at scale, Kotak owns capital discipline, AU owns semi-urban underwriting, Federal rents its licence to fintechs, IndusInd owns vehicle and microfinance domain knowledge, and the regional banks own their districts. None of them owns the customer relationship at the point of transaction β€” and that is where the next threat comes from.

7. Value Chain, Suppliers, and the Open Credit Enablement Threat

When a customer taps "apply" in an Indian banking application, roughly two seconds elapse before a decision appears. Inside those two seconds, a chain of institutions is invoked in sequence, most of which the customer has never heard of and several of which the bank does not own. Understanding who sits where in that chain is how you work out where the profit will eventually settle.

Walk it from the customer inward.

At the touchpoint layer sits whatever the customer is actually looking at: a bank's own app, a branch, a fintech application, or increasingly a merchant's checkout screen. Ownership of this layer determines who controls the relationship.

Behind it sits the distribution and aggregation layer β€” fintech applications, marketplace lenders, and the emerging OCEN protocol that standardises how a credit offer is requested and returned. This layer is where customer intent is captured.

Beneath that is the data layer: the Account Aggregator protocol governed by Sahamati, which moves consented financial data between institutions, and the credit bureaus β€” TransUnion CIBIL, Experian and CRIF High Mark β€” which supply the borrower's existing obligations and repayment history to every scheduled commercial bank in India.7 Bureau data and aggregator data answer different questions. The bureau tells you what the borrower already owes. The aggregator tells you what the borrower earns. A lender needs both, and neither is optional.

Then the payment interoperability layer: the National Payments Corporation of India, which operates UPI, the RuPay card network, the Immediate Payment Service and the Aadhaar-enabled payment system.1 Every scheduled commercial bank connects to NPCI. There is no alternative switch. This is a regulated utility structure, and it is the most consequential chokepoint in Indian finance β€” an NPCI outage is a national event, and NPCI's pricing decisions on interchange and merchant discount rates directly determine whether payments are a revenue line or a cost line for banks. To date they have largely been a cost line, absorbed as the price of customer relationship and data.

Beneath the switch sits the core banking system β€” the ledger of record. Infosys supplies Finacle to State Bank of India, ICICI Bank, Axis Bank and Punjab National Bank; Tata Consultancy Services supplies TCS BaNCS to HDFC Bank, Bank of Baroda and IDFC First Bank; Oracle supplies Flexcube to Kotak Mahindra Bank, IndusInd Bank and AU Small Finance Bank. These relationships are confirmed in public vendor disclosures and bank filings.

Core banking is the stickiest supplier relationship in the industry, and the reason is switching cost rather than technical superiority. Replacing a core banking platform at a bank with tens of millions of accounts is a multi-year programme with a non-trivial probability of a visible failure, and bank boards that have watched peers suffer regulatory censure for technology outages are not enthusiastic buyers of that risk. The practical consequence is that vendors hold real pricing leverage on maintenance and enhancement, while banks hold leverage only at the point of initial selection or after a major failure. The dependency runs both directions: the vendors need these accounts because Indian banking is a reference market that sells their platforms globally, and a public failure at a marquee client is expensive.

At the bottom sits cloud and AI infrastructure β€” Amazon Web Services, Microsoft Azure and Google Cloud, which host analytics, model training, fraud detection and customer service systems for the private banks and their fintech partners in hybrid configurations. This relationship is credibly reported through hyperscaler financial-services case studies rather than through bank disclosure, and it should be read as partial rather than total: core ledgers in Indian banking have largely remained on-premises or in private infrastructure, with cloud used for the analytical and customer-facing tiers.

And at the base of the stack sits the thing none of the suppliers own: the bank balance sheet, with its licence, its deposits, its capital and its credit risk.

Where the money and the power actually sit

Now the analytical question. Across that chain, who earns what?

The core banking vendors earn a steady, low-volatility software toll β€” attractive economics, but a toll that scales with a bank's account count rather than with its profits, and is small in absolute terms relative to the bank's P&L. The bureaus earn a per-enquiry fee on an oligopoly structure with genuine data network effects: the more lenders report to CIBIL, the more valuable CIBIL's file is to each lender, which is a textbook scale-economy moat. NPCI, as a not-for-profit utility, deliberately does not extract economic rent from the payment rail; the surplus flows to consumers and merchants in the form of free instant payments. Sahamati likewise operates as a non-monetising standard-setter.

The unusual feature of the Indian stack is therefore this: the most powerful infrastructure layers have been placed, by policy design, outside the profit motive. That is why no private Indian company occupies the position that Visa and Mastercard occupy in the United States, or that a dominant payment app occupies in several other emerging markets. It is also the strongest single argument for why Indian banks retained their economics through the fintech era while banks elsewhere did not.

The banks, meanwhile, earn the spread and bear the credit risk, the capital requirement, the liquidity requirement and the regulatory obligation. That is the trade. It is a good trade when the bank also owns the customer.

The OCEN threat, stated precisely

Which brings us to the one development that could break it.

The Open Credit Enablement Network standardises loan origination the way UPI standardised payments. If it achieves comparable adoption, any application with a customer relationship β€” a payments app, a messaging platform, an e-commerce checkout, the software a neighbourhood retailer uses to manage inventory β€” can present a credit offer at the exact moment the customer needs money, with a regulated lender's balance sheet behind it.

The mechanism by which this destroys bank economics is not disintermediation of the balance sheet. Banks would still hold the loans; capital regulation guarantees it. The mechanism is the commoditisation of origination. If five banks bid to fund the same loan presented by the same platform to the same borrower, the platform captures the origination economics and the banks compete the spread down to the cost of capital plus credit risk. The bank becomes a balance sheet utility β€” profitable, regulated, and structurally unable to earn an excess return.

The observable milestone to watch is the share of MSME working capital originations reaching banks through embedded non-bank applications rather than through bank channels. If that crosses roughly 30%, the bargaining power has moved.

Two counterweights are worth stating fairly. First, the Reserve Bank has consistently intervened when non-bank entities accumulated bank-like power without bank-like regulation β€” the restrictions imposed on Paytm Payments Bank being the most visible instance β€” which caps how much of the value chain an unregulated platform can occupy. Second, origination is not the only thing banks own; the deposit relationship, the salary account, the mortgage and the wealth relationship are far stickier than a single working-capital loan, and platforms have shown little appetite for the regulated, capital-intensive work of gathering deposits.

Federal Bank's model is the live experiment in what a partner-bank future looks like, and its returns β€” 1.28% RoA against ICICI's 2.38% β€” are a reasonable first estimate of what a bank earns when someone else owns the customer.98 The consequence is a permanently lower multiple rather than a catastrophe.

Where value ultimately settles between the app and the balance sheet is the open question. The global evidence on that question comes from markets that ran the experiment first.

8. Public-Market Expressions & Expectation Wedges: Pure Plays, Value PSBs, and False Positives

In mid-2026 the Indian banking sector traded across a valuation range that would look implausible in most developed markets. ICICI Bank changed hands at roughly 2.7 times adjusted book value, State Bank of India near 1.2 times, and Bank of Baroda below book at about 0.95 times.81318 Three institutions in the same country, under the same regulator, the same rate cycle and the same credit environment, priced across a spread of nearly three times. That dispersion is where the investment question lives. The businesses genuinely differ, so the spread is not obviously wrong β€” but it embeds assumptions that can be extracted and tested.

Exhibit 4 β€” Indian bank financial read-through and valuation, FY2026 Definition: reported net interest income (β‚Ή crore), net interest margin, cost-to-income, gross NPA ratio, return on assets, return on equity and price to adjusted book value. Geography: India. Period: FY2026 (year ended 31 March 2026) results; P/ABV as at mid-2026. Source: company quarterly and annual disclosures; Indian exchange prices. Evidence status: reported financials observed; P/ABV is a point-in-time market price and adjusted book definitions vary modestly between banks.

Bank NII (β‚Ή cr) NIM (%) Cost-to-income (%) Gross NPA (%) RoA (%) RoE (%) P/ABV (x)
ICICI Bank ~82,500 4.25 39.2 1.40 2.38 18.5 ~2.7
HDFC Bank ~118,000 3.45 40.1 1.24 1.95 16.2 ~2.2
State Bank of India ~168,000 3.05 52.8 2.10 1.12 15.8 ~1.2
Axis Bank ~52,000 3.95 48.5 1.35 1.78 16.8 ~1.8
Kotak Mahindra Bank ~27,500 4.80 46.8 1.20 2.15 14.5 ~2.1
IDFC First Bank ~18,200 6.10 69.5 1.88 1.15 10.8 ~1.5
Federal Bank ~9,200 3.18 51.2 2.05 1.28 14.2 ~1.3
Bank of Baroda ~45,000 3.12 47.8 2.25 1.05 16.1 ~0.95

Read down the return-on-equity column and something odd appears. SBI at 15.8% and Bank of Baroda at 16.1% post returns on equity comparable to HDFC Bank's 16.2% and above Kotak's 14.5% β€” yet trade at a third to half the multiple. The explanation sits in the RoA column. Public sector banks reach their returns on equity through leverage of roughly 13 times, against about 8 times for the leading private banks. Identical RoE built on materially more leverage is a lower-quality return: more fragile to a credit shock, more likely to require dilution when one arrives. The discount reflects the composition of the return plus a governance and policy-mandate risk that has repeatedly proven real.

What each expression requires, and what would break it

ICICI Bank is the purest expression of the digital-underwriting thesis among large banks, and its exposure is directly proven: retail and business banking above 68% of loans, RoA of 2.38%, cost-to-income of 39.2%, and an open-architecture app funnelling more than 12 million non-customers.8 At roughly 2.7 times adjusted book, the price requires sustained return on equity above 17% with no meaningful asset quality deterioration β€” continuation of the best operating performance in the industry. The variant case rests on operating leverage still to come from the API architecture pushing RoA toward 2.5%, and on the arithmetic that every 10 basis points of systemic credit cost reduction adds roughly β‚Ή1,280 crore to pre-tax profit.8 The first smart objection: at 2.7 times book you are paying a premium multiple against an above-mid-cycle credit cost, and 1.40% gross NPAs is not a number that survives a downturn. What would kill the company thesis is retail unsecured default rates rising through 2.5%, or RoA below 1.60% or gross NPAs above 2.80% for two consecutive quarters.

HDFC Bank presents the clearest identifiable expectations gap in the sector, and it is a timing gap rather than a quality gap. The fundamentals are not in dispute: roughly 19% of system deposits, 20% of system credit, a balance sheet above β‚Ή38 lakh crore.12 What is disputed is how quickly the post-merger credit-to-deposit ratio normalises from near 100% toward the historic 85% range, and therefore when the margin recovers from 3.45%. At about 2.2 times adjusted book β€” a discount to its own long-run multiple and to ICICI β€” the price appears to assume a slow recovery. The mechanical wedge is that every 10 basis points of margin expansion adds roughly β‚Ή2,500 crore to net interest income, the largest such sensitivity in the sector.12 If deposits keep compounding at 14.4% against advances at 12.0%, the ratio closes faster than that assumption implies. The objection: deposit growth of that magnitude is bought with term deposits, and a bank funding itself with expensive money does not recover its old margin merely by fixing a ratio. The kill criterion is deposit growth falling below credit growth for four consecutive quarters.

State Bank of India is the liability-moat expression, at about 1.2 times adjusted book excluding subsidiaries, with a 23% deposit share, a 41% CASA ratio, and enormous sensitivity: a 10-basis-point reduction in deposit cost lifts net interest income by roughly β‚Ή4,800 crore.13 The variant argument is that in a deposit war the institution that does not have to bid gains relative advantage, so SBI's margin should hold while private peers compress; there is also value in subsidiaries β€” SBI Funds Management, SBI General Insurance, the YONO platform β€” inside an entity valued largely on standalone bank earnings. The objection is immediate: the PSU discount has persisted for two decades and may correctly price the risk that the majority shareholder is also the policy-setter. A direction to lend into unremunerative priority projects, or a wage revision cycle, converts shareholder value into public policy with no recourse. The kill criteria are net NPAs above 1.25% or Tier-1 below 10.5%.

Axis Bank is a restructuring and integration story. The Citi India acquisition delivered around three million affluent card and wealth customers and a credit card share near 14%, feeding the fee-income migration described earlier.16 At roughly 1.8 times book, expectations sit meaningfully below ICICI's β€” either an opportunity or an accurate reading of execution risk. Every 20 basis points of cost-to-income improvement adds roughly β‚Ή850 crore to operating profit, and with cost-to-income at 48.5% against ICICI's 39.2% that runway is the whole thesis.16 The objection: acquired card portfolios have a habit of producing worse loss experience than the acquirer modelled, and integration synergies are announced more reliably than delivered. Credit costs breaking 1.50% of advances would settle it.

Kotak Mahindra Bank is the de-rated quality franchise, at roughly 2.1 times book against a prior 3.5 times on 2.15% RoA and the peer set's strongest capital position.15 The wedge, if it exists, is that regulatory remediation releases a customer-acquisition constraint on a balance sheet already carrying surplus capital: the capacity to grow is present and only the permission is missing. The objection is that undeployable excess capital is a drag rather than an option, and remediation timelines at Indian banks have historically run long. Deposit growth slowing below 10% year on year signals the constraint is binding rather than temporary.

IDFC First Bank is the operating-leverage bet. At roughly 1.5 times book on 1.15% RoA and 10.8% RoE, the market is paying for a cost ratio that has not yet fallen.14 The mechanics are stark: at 69.5% cost-to-income, revenue growth that outpaces cost growth compounds into pre-provision profit at a rate no already-efficient bank can match, and reaching 58% would transform the earnings. The objection has ended every previous version of this story: high-yield unsecured and consumer-durable lending produces its cost efficiencies in benign conditions and its losses in bad ones, and a bank growing above 20% on 1.15% RoA must return to shareholders for equity. The kill criteria are gross credit costs above 2.2% or failure to bring cost-to-income below 65% by FY27.

AU Small Finance Bank at roughly 2.7 times book requires two things to go right at once β€” the universal banking licence and the Fincare integration β€” on a franchise growing advances 24% at 5.50% margins.3 The objection is that a premium multiple on a small finance bank has historically been a bet on the absence of a microfinance credit event, and such events are periodic rather than random. Gross NPAs breaking 3.0% or post-merger RoA below 1.2% ends it.

Federal Bank, Bank of Baroda, IndusInd Bank and Punjab National Bank occupy the value end. Federal at 1.3 times is priced for its structurally lower margin, with the fintech partnership model as the optionality and the regulatory treatment of those partnerships as the risk.9 Bank of Baroda below book with 16.1% RoE and a 4.5% dividend yield is the sector's closest thing to a statistically cheap asset, gated on whether digital onboarding is restored before it loses retail deposit share.18 IndusInd at 1.5 times is a rural credit-cycle bet wearing a bank's clothes.19 PNB at 0.85 times is priced for the recovery to be cyclical, and the burden of proof sits with the bank.17

The crowding question, and two false positives

One positioning fact changes portfolio risk rather than company quality. HDFC Bank, ICICI Bank and Axis Bank together represent more than 30% of total foreign institutional investor allocation to Indian equities, with net foreign flows into the banking sector running at approximately +$1.2 billion year-to-date in 2026.11 A redemption cycle in emerging-market funds therefore produces correlated selling across all three regardless of their individual earnings, and an investor holding all three has less diversification than the ticker count suggests.

Two categories of apparent beneficiary do not survive scrutiny.

The first is the monoline unsecured lender, valued on total-addressable-market logic β€” the assertion that Indian personal loans and buy-now-pay-later credit can compound above 25% for a decade because penetration is low. The evidence points the other way. Bureau data shows multi-lender stacking concentrated in exactly this cohort, the RBI has already raised risk weights by 25 percentage points to slow it, and the growth rate consistent with stable loss experience is closer to 12–15%.74 A valuation requiring the higher number is priced on a growth rate the regulator has explicitly acted to prevent.

The second is the sub-scale small finance bank, sold as a high-yield asset book plus a banking licence and therefore a superior compounding vehicle. The economics say otherwise: it pays above-market rates for deposits precisely because it lacks brand and branch density, competes for borrowers against universal banks now equipped with the same digital rails, and lacks capital depth to absorb a credit cycle without dilution. High yield earned on expensive funding through a costly network is a spread that disappears when either input moves.

The competing frame comes from outside India, where the same disruption ran a decade earlier and produced a very different market structure.

9. Global Parallels & Future Game Changers: Nubank Lessons, CBDC Disintermediation, and AI Fraud

Three cities offer three different answers to the question of what happens to banks when technology arrives.

SΓ£o Paulo: what happens when the incumbents are bad

Nu Holdings β€” Nubank β€” is the most successful digital bank ever built, and the reason is not primarily technology. By early 2026 it served more than 100 million active customers across Brazil, Mexico and Colombia, with a cost to serve below $1 per active user per month, a net interest margin near 9.8% and return on assets above 4.0%.20 Those figures are extraordinary in absolute terms and require context to interpret.

Nubank grew into an oligopoly. Brazilian retail banking before its arrival was concentrated among a handful of institutions charging fees consumers found punitive, on service that gave customers reason to leave. A challenger offering a no-fee credit card and a decent app was counter-positioned against incumbents who could not respond without cannibalising their own fee revenue β€” the classic structure in which the attacker's advantage is the defender's unwillingness rather than inability. The 9.8% margin likewise reflects Brazilian rate levels and unsecured consumer spreads rather than a technology dividend; comparing it with an Indian bank's 4% as though the gap measured efficiency would be a category error.

The Indian counterfactual is the interesting part. India never produced a Nubank, and the reason is that the Indian state built the disruption itself. UPI made payments free and interoperable before any private platform could establish a proprietary network. Aadhaar made identity verification a public utility rather than a private data moat. The Account Aggregator framework made financial data portable without creating a data monopolist. Each of these decisions removed a layer of value that, in Brazil or the United States, a private disruptor could have captured. What remained for a private entrant was the deposit franchise and the credit risk β€” precisely the regulated, capital-intensive, slow-compounding parts.

The market fear of the late 2010s was that Paytm, PhonePe and their peers would disintermediate Indian banks. The outcome was the reverse: those platforms became distribution channels for regulated lenders, constrained by first-loss-guarantee caps and, in one prominent case, by direct regulatory action against a payments bank. India's public infrastructure protected its banks' economics more effectively than any amount of private defensive spending could have.

New York and Tokyo: scale and rates

JPMorgan Chase demonstrates a different lesson, and one Indian bank managements study closely: at sufficient scale, technology investment and physical distribution reinforce rather than substitute for each other. A bank that can spend at global-leader levels on technology while retaining branch density in its core markets builds a position that neither a pure digital entrant nor a pure branch incumbent can attack. The relevant Indian parallel is not any single bank but the emerging structure: the largest three or four private banks are pulling away from the mid-sized field on exactly this combination. We do not reproduce JPMorgan's disclosed financials here; the parallel that matters is architectural rather than quantitative.

Mitsubishi UFJ and the Japanese banks illustrate the opposite constraint. A banking system operating for decades in a near-zero rate environment discovers that deposit franchises are worth very little when there is no spread to earn on them, and that the value of a bank is often a leveraged bet on the direction of policy rates rather than on anything management does. The Indian relevance is a caution: SBI's deposit moat is worth what it is worth because Indian rates are positive and real. In a permanently low-rate India β€” an unlikely but not impossible future β€” the most valuable asset in Indian banking would become close to worthless.

Three developments that could reorder the value pool

Central bank digital currency and the deposit franchise. The Reserve Bank has run retail digital rupee pilots for several years. In their current form they are payment instruments with holding limits and no interest, which makes them a substitute for cash rather than for deposits. The mechanism that would matter is different: if the RBI ever permitted interest-bearing retail e-rupee balances, or raised individual holding limits substantially β€” the frequently discussed threshold being β‚Ή50 lakh per individual β€” then a household could hold a risk-free, sovereign-backed, instantly transferable balance directly on the central bank's balance sheet. In ordinary times that would raise banks' cost of funds as low-cost current and savings balances migrated. In a stress event it would be far worse, because a digital run toward the central bank has no friction at all.

Who loses: every bank whose valuation rests on a cheap deposit franchise, which in India means SBI most of all and the large private banks nearly as much. Who gains: nobody in the listed banking universe, though lenders funded predominantly by term deposits and wholesale markets would suffer relatively less because they never had the advantage in the first place. The observable milestones are specific β€” any RBI move toward paying interest on retail e-rupee holdings, or raising holding limits into the tens of lakhs. Neither has occurred. This belongs in the category of emerging signal rather than investable theme, and the correct posture is monitoring rather than positioning.

OCEN and embedded credit. Treated in Section 7, and worth restating here as the middle-probability, medium-timeline risk. Announced protocols and pilot integrations are not scaled commercial adoption; the milestone that would confirm the shift is embedded non-bank applications accounting for more than 30% of MSME working capital originations.

Generative AI and synthetic identity fraud. This is the most underpriced risk in the digital lending thesis, because it attacks the mechanism the thesis depends on. An instant loan approval system is an automated decision made without human contact on the basis of documents and data. Generative models have made synthetic identity construction and document forgery cheap, scalable and difficult to detect at the point of application. The attack does not need to defeat a bank's underwriting model; it needs only to defeat the verification layer that feeds it.

The mechanism by which this damages economics is worth spelling out. Fraud losses on instant digital loans appear in early-vintage delinquency β€” defaults in the zero-to-ninety-day window, where a genuine borrower would normally have made at least one payment. A sudden rise in that metric across multiple digital lenders simultaneously is the signature. The response, once detected, is to reintroduce human verification touchpoints: video KYC with live review, physical address confirmation, callbacks. Each of those restores the customer acquisition costs that the digital rail eliminated. The theme's central financial claim β€” that acquisition costs fell 60–70% and stay fallen β€” is the claim under attack.

The beneficiaries in that scenario would be lenders with existing customer relationships and verified histories, who need to onboard fewer strangers. The losers would be the digital-first challengers whose entire growth model is acquiring customers they have never met. It would also, ironically, restore some of the advantage of the branch network β€” the asset the whole industry has spent a decade treating as a cost.

India's public infrastructure has, so far, protected its banks from the disintermediation that reshaped banking elsewhere. What it has not protected them from is the two risks that come from the same direction as the benefit: a sovereign that could compete for deposits directly, and an automation layer that can be attacked by automation.

10. The Monitoring Dashboard & Crux KPIs: The Falsification Map

Everything above reduces to a hierarchy of observables. Structural: currency in circulation as a share of GDP and household net financial savings β€” annual, lagging indicators of a slow variable. Adoption: Account Aggregator consent volumes, monthly. Industry: the system credit-to-deposit ratio, weekly. Company: slippage rates, quarterly. Market: foreign institutional flows into banking β€” monthly, noisy and lagging.

Four are load-bearing, set out below with the mechanism that makes each lead rather than lag, the disagreement each discriminates, and the threshold that changes the conclusion.

Crux KPI 1: System credit-to-deposit growth delta

What it measures: the percentage-point difference between year-on-year system credit growth and deposit growth.

Why it leads: it sits directly on the binding constraint. Margins are an outcome; the funding gap is the cause. When credit outgrows deposits by more than about 300 basis points for a sustained period, banks must bid for bulk and term deposits, and the cost reaches net interest margin two to three quarters later. By the time compression appears in reported earnings, the delta has been signalling it for a year.

Which disagreement it settles: the bear argument is that Indian banks must permanently choose between margin and growth because household savings cannot fund 13% credit expansion; the bull argument is that deposit growth accelerates as real incomes rise and the RBI eases reserve requirements. Where it sits: industry level, coincident-to-leading.

Source, cadence and latest reading: Reserve Bank of India fortnightly scheduled bank statement; +2.2 percentage points as at mid-2026, being credit growth of 12.0% against deposit growth of 9.8%.10

Confirm or break: the thesis strengthens if the delta narrows below +1.0 percentage point. It breaks if the delta expands beyond +4.0 points for two consecutive readings, forcing either credit rationing or a step-change in funding costs; the system credit-to-deposit ratio breaking above 83% carries the same message.

Crux KPI 2: Account Aggregator digital credit disbursement share

What it measures: the share of retail and MSME loan origination value processed through Account Aggregator consent rails, in per cent.

Why it leads: it measures whether cash-flow underwriting is being used, as distinct from being available. Every claimed benefit of the theme β€” lower acquisition cost, lower credit cost, higher return on assets β€” flows through this rail, and adoption precedes the cost savings, which precede the margin improvement, which precede the earnings.

Which disagreement it settles: the bull case holds that Account Aggregator integration permanently lowers operating costs by roughly 40 basis points and credit costs by 30 basis points; the bear case holds that consent-based sharing works only for prime borrowers who were already documented and adds little where the informal-sector risk sits. If adoption stalls in the mid-teens, the bear case is being demonstrated. Where it sits: adoption level, leading.

Source, cadence and latest reading: Sahamati ecosystem dashboard, monthly and quarterly; approximately 15.2% of retail and MSME origination value as at mid-2026, alongside monthly consent volumes near 12.5 million and cumulative account links above 110 million.2

Confirm or break: confirmed if disbursement share crosses 25% by end-FY27; broken if it plateaus below 18%, indicating friction in consumer consent or bank API integration the technology has not overcome. A stated limitation: this captures value through the formal AA rail and understates lending that uses cash-flow data obtained elsewhere. It is a proxy for cash-flow underwriting adoption, not a census of it.

Crux KPI 3: Net slippage ratio

What it measures: annualised fresh non-performing asset additions, net of write-offs and recoveries, as a percentage of opening gross advances.

Why it leads: it is the earliest point at which asset quality deterioration becomes visible in disclosed data. Gross NPA ratios lag because they are a stock affected by write-offs and recoveries; credit cost lags further because it reflects provisioning policy. Slippages are the flow, and they turn two to three quarters before the headline metrics.

Which disagreement it settles: whether post-COVID unsecured retail and MSME vintages produce a delinquency wave as they season into a weaker income environment, or whether bureau coverage and cash-flow monitoring hold slippages permanently below 1.5%. Nothing in this article's structural argument survives if slippages break out. Where it sits: company level, leading.

Source, cadence and latest reading: bank quarterly disclosures and investor presentations; approximately 1.10% annualised across top private banks and 1.65% for public sector banks in Q4 FY26.

Confirm or break: confirming if top private net slippages stay below 1.25%; breaking if they exceed 2.20% for two consecutive quarters, at which point the credit cost assumption embedded in every valuation in Exhibit 4 is wrong.

Crux KPI 4: Provision coverage ratio, excluding write-offs

What it measures: cumulative bad-debt provisions held on balance sheet divided by gross non-performing assets, in per cent.

Why it leads: it measures the buffer before credit losses reach equity, and it matters most at the moment of regulatory change. The transition to expected credit loss provisioning requires forward-looking provisions; institutions already above 75% coverage absorb it with minimal capital impact, while under-provisioned lenders take a real charge. Coverage today tells you who will be hurt by a rule change that has not yet fully arrived.

Which disagreement it settles: whether the reported balance-sheet strength of Indian banks is genuine or an artefact of a lenient provisioning regime about to be replaced. Where it sits: structural-to-industry level, leading with respect to the ECL transition.

Source, cadence and latest reading: RBI Financial Stability Report, biannual, plus bank quarterly filings; 79.5% systemwide for scheduled commercial banks in early-to-mid 2026.4

Confirm or break: confirming if system coverage holds above 75% through the ECL transition; breaking if it falls below 65%, indicating provisioning has not kept pace with the loan book.

Duplicated bets and hidden factor exposure

A portfolio of Indian bank equities can look diversified by name and be a single position by cause. Three overlaps matter. Holding ICICI Bank, Axis Bank and IDFC First Bank together concentrates exposure to the unsecured retail credit cycle β€” urban consumer default rates and RBI risk-weight policy β€” the same bet expressed three ways, on a rule the regulator has already shown willingness to change. Any combination of mid-sized private banks running credit-to-deposit ratios above 85% duplicates exposure to the liquidity and rate cycle; their business models differ, their funding vulnerability does not. And the concentration of foreign institutional ownership in the three largest private banks means a global emerging-market allocation decision moves all of them together, independently of anything happening in Indian credit.11 An investor who wanted Indian financialization and bought global EM risk appetite has the wrong instrument for the thesis.

Theme kill criteria and security kill criteria are frequently confused and are not the same. The theme dies if top-tier private net interest margins fall structurally below 3.20% while cost-to-income ratios fail to improve despite a digital transaction mix above 80%, which would demonstrate the digital dividend was competed away rather than retained; it also dies if system credit-to-deposit breaks 85% for two consecutive quarters, or if top private slippages exceed 2.20%. The security kill criteria are the company-specific tests named in Section 8, and a bank can fail its own test while the theme holds, or hold up while the theme fails around it.

Where the upstream belief stands

Return to the proposition that sent us here: that India's formalization is permanently re-routing household savings into the formal financial system, creating an expanding, low-credit-cost intermediation pool for well-capitalised lenders.

On the evidence available at the end of July 2026, the belief is holding. The asset side is confirmed beyond serious dispute β€” 15 billion UPI transactions a month, 110 million Account Aggregator links, 440 million bureau-covered borrowers, and gross NPAs at 2.1% against a peak of 11.5% eight years earlier. Cash is not returning; currency in circulation to GDP remains contained near 11.5%, and households are saving in financial form at roughly 11.2% of gross national disposable income.

It is fraying in one place, and it is the place the original framing understated. Formalization has been far more successful at creating borrowers than at creating depositors. The same digital rails that turned an invisible tea vendor into a bankable customer also turned a captive savings account holder into someone who can move β‚Ή5,000 a month into an equity fund from a phone. Five consecutive years of credit outgrowing deposits is the measurable consequence. The intermediation pool is expanding, as the belief predicted; the cheap part of it is not.

That is why the investment conclusion does not follow automatically from the social forecast. An investor could have been entirely right about India's financialization since 2021 and still lost money by owning the wrong layer β€” the asset originator rather than the liability holder, the high-margin challenger rather than the low-cost monolith. The theme is real. The scarce resource inside it turned out to be the oldest thing in banking: other people's money, cheaply obtained, and kept.

Glossary

CASA (current and savings account) ratio β€” the share of a bank's deposits held in current and savings accounts rather than term deposits. These accounts pay little or no interest, so a high CASA ratio directly lowers a bank's cost of funds. In India it is the single best predictor of which banks survive a deposit war with margins intact.

CRAR (capital to risk-weighted assets ratio) β€” a bank's Tier-1 and Tier-2 capital divided by its risk-weighted exposures. The RBI requires a minimum of 9% plus a capital conservation buffer. It determines how much a bank can grow before it must raise equity.

Credit-to-deposit (C/D) ratio β€” total outstanding loans divided by total customer deposits. Above roughly 80–85% a bank is funding loans with borrowings rather than deposits, which is more expensive and less stable. It is the industry's central constraint in 2026.

D-SIB (domestic systemically important bank) β€” banks designated by the RBI as too important to fail, currently State Bank of India, HDFC Bank and ICICI Bank. Designation carries additional capital requirements and, implicitly, a stronger official backstop.

ECL (expected credit loss) β€” a provisioning framework under Ind-AS 109 requiring banks to provide for losses expected over a loan's life at the point of origination, rather than after a default occurs. Its adoption in India will penalise under-provisioned lenders and barely touch well-provisioned ones.

GNPA / NNPA (gross and net non-performing assets) β€” loans overdue more than 90 days, expressed as a share of advances. Net NPA subtracts provisions already held. The gap between the two measures how honestly a bank has provisioned.

LCR (liquidity coverage ratio) β€” the stock of high-quality liquid assets a bank must hold to survive 30 days of severe stress, with a 100% minimum. The RBI's draft revision assumes digitally connected retail deposits run off twice as fast as branch deposits, which raises the cost of being a mobile-first bank.

NIM (net interest margin) β€” net interest income as a percentage of average interest-earning assets. It measures gross spread, not profitability, and is not comparable across banks with different asset mixes and cost structures.

OCEN (Open Credit Enablement Network) β€” a protocol standardising loan-origination APIs so that any application can present a credit offer backed by a regulated lender. If it scales, it moves origination economics from banks to customer-facing platforms.

PCR (provision coverage ratio) β€” provisions held against gross non-performing assets, as a percentage. It measures the cushion between a credit problem and a bank's equity.

PPOP (pre-provision operating profit) β€” revenue less operating expenses, before credit provisions. It is the cleanest measure of a bank's underlying earnings power because it strips out the most discretionary line on the income statement.

PSL (priority sector lending) β€” the RBI requirement that 40% of adjusted net bank credit go to agriculture, MSMEs, affordable housing and weaker sections, with shortfalls parked in low-yielding NABARD deposits. It is a real, invisible tax on banks whose natural customer base sits outside those sectors.
